Performance
As mentioned, this is the most powerful EV produced by BMW. The motor on the front axle puts out 489bhp on its own. Coupled with the 258bhp motor at the rear, the M70 has a combined output of 660bhp of peak power according to BMW, I’m not sure their maths checks out there. What’s most impressive though is the torque figure, a rather healthy 1100Nm.
All of this is enough to propel the massive 7 from 0-60 in just 3.7 seconds. Top speed is a very German 155mph, so no surprises there. Thankfully, it does feature launch control. BMW have said: “With the M Launch Control function, both drive and traction control are integrated into the engine control unit. This ensures the power generated by the electric motors is metered extremely precisely, allowing the drive system’s M-typical performance characteristics to be instantly converted into stunning acceleration without any loss of traction.”

Economy
BMW state the i7 will manage around 303 – 348 miles according to the WLTP cycle. Thanks in part to the battery that provides 101.7 kWh of usable energy, which is quite sizeable. The car’s range can be extended while on the move by activating a new drive system setting. The launch of the BMW i7 M70 xDrive marks the introduction of a MAX RANGE mode for the all-electric models in the new BMW 7 Series range. In this mode, drive power and top speed are carefully restricted and comfort functions scaled back, allowing range to be increased by some 15 to 25 per cent.

There’s no official word on the construction of the battery itself but it does have a wealth of measures for reducing power consumption. These include adaptive regen when braking and the heat pump technology used in the integrated heating and cooling system for the cabin and powertrain.
There’s also ‘MAX RANGE’ feature on the car which limits top speed to 56mph. At the same time, the climate control system is deactivated and the rear window heating switches to a lower setting (if on), seat heating, seat ventilation and the steering wheel heating are all turned off too. BMW state that this should increase battery charge by an extra 15 – 25%.
In terms of performance, the motor is BMW’s 5th generation of their eDrive unit and uses six excitation windings in the motor’s stator instead of the usually found three. They also state that due to its unique construction, no rare-earth metals are used.
